The South Korea Threat Modeling Tools Market is experiencing significant growth due to the increasing awareness of cybersecurity threats and the need for robust security measures among organizations in the country. Threat modeling tools are being increasingly adopted to identify vulnerabilities, assess risks, and enhance the overall security posture of businesses. Key players in the South Korea market are offering a wide range of solutions tailored to the specific needs of industries such as finance, healthcare, and government. The market is characterized by intense competition, with companies focusing on innovation and technological advancements to stay ahead. The growing emphasis on data protection and regulatory compliance further drives the demand for threat modeling tools in South Korea, making it a promising market for vendors and investors alike.

In the South Korea Threat Modeling Tools Market, challenges include the need for increased awareness and adoption of threat modeling practices among organizations. Many companies in South Korea may not fully understand the benefits of using threat modeling tools or may lack the expertise to effectively implement them. Additionally, cultural factors such as a preference for reactive security measures over proactive ones can hinder the market growth. Furthermore, the presence of language barriers and regulatory requirements specific to the South Korean market can pose challenges for threat modeling tool providers looking to enter and establish a strong presence in the region. Overcoming these challenges will require targeted education efforts, localized marketing strategies, and tailored solutions to address the unique needs of South Korean organizations.
